Low ESD safety shoes ideal for use in ATEX zones
The Jakaro shoes are designed for professionals in the electronics industry. Compliant with standard EN ISO 20345: 2011 SRC ESD, these safety slippers meet the requirements of high-tech sectors:
- dissipation of electrostatic charges,
- compatibility with ATEX environments,
- slip and hydrocarbon resistance,
- steel toe with impact and crush resistance,
- antistatic properties.
With their low shaft and laceless fit, these S2 safety shoes are very easy to slip on. The elasticated instep ensures a secure fit. You'll love Parade's VPS SYSTEM technology, which supports the natural arch of the foot and the dual-density polyurethane sole for a lighter weight. The removable, anatomical, antibacterial and anti-fungal insole ensures comfort and hygiene. The microfibre material of Jakaro is easy to clean with soap and water. VPS (suspended arch support)
The shoe's ergonomic shape maintains the natural arch of the foot, following the arch's curve. This support inside the sole itself provides unrivalled comfort, particularly in the case of small or shuffling steps and extended periods of standing still.

Life Cycle Assessment (LCA)
At Parade, we carry out a life cycle analysis to measure the environmental impact of each of our models: from the extraction of raw materials, manufacturing, use, logistics, right through to the end of the product's life. Our environmental impact calculators, developed in-house using ADEME's EMPREINTE® database, have been certified by AFNOR for textiles and validated by the Eco-design Cluster* for footwear.
*The Eco-design cluster is the national center for eco-design and life-cycle performance. Its expertise is recognized nationally and internationally by ADEME, the French Ministry of the Environment, AFNOR, ISO and the UN-environment.
